English
Lesson Category
Price
Lesson time
Speaks
Teachers from
More
Community Tutor
Clear all

2062 English tutors available

Our English teachers and tutors are experienced and passionate about helping students improve their language skills. Whether you are looking for one-on-one lessons or group classes, our platform offers a flexible and convenient way to learn from the comfort of your home.

Learn English with the teacher Alex S.
5.0

8,420 Lessons

Alex S

Community Tutorid verified
Speaks :English
Native
Hebrew
Native
Spanish
Native
Russian
Native
+1

⭐ International Polyglot ⭐ Having worked at retreat centers, speaking closely with people overcoming trauma, gave me valuable experience that I can transfer into my work as a teacher. This experience led me to meet people with acceptance and patience, understanding that each one of us has their own personal journey, and that wherever we are, we can work together to remove blockages (such as with learning new subjects) and find balance, reaching whatever set goal at a comfortable pace.

USD 18.00/trial
Available 07:00 Tomorrow
Learn English with the teacher Hanna.
5.0

2,963 Lessons

Hanna

Community Tutorid verified
Speaks :English
Russian
Native
Ukrainian
German
+3

✨ Personalized lessons to help you speak with confidence! 🎯 I see myself as more than just a teacher - I’m also a guide, a friend, and a fellow learner. My goal is to create a supportive and engaging environment where you feel comfortable, motivated, and excited about learning. I carefully structure our lessons to match your individual goals, providing homework assignments, tracking your progress, and regularly revising material to ensure steady improvement. With over four years of teaching experience and a strong background in communication, I am confident in my ability to guide you toward success. Let’s make this journey effective, enjoyable, and rewarding together! 📖

USD 15.00/trial
Learn English with the teacher Jessica Rebekah.
5.0

12.4k Lessons

Jessica Rebekah

Community Tutorid verified
Business
Kids
Test Preparation
Speaks :English
Native
Hebrew
+1

Practice is the key to success! I have been helping people with English online around the world since 2014 (and on italki since 2018) focusing on conversational, vocabulary, grammar, pronunciation and reading skills. I have a TEFL certificate (Teaching English to Foreign Learners) and IELTS speaking certificate. Learning English should be enjoyable. There may be days when you might feel discouraged or unmotivated, but that should never stop you from achieving your dream. Important to note - I teach my students with respect and courtesy and appreciate it when they treat me the same. I believe in teaching you to expand your vocabulary and communicate appropriately in English so please no swearing or dirty words.

USD 10.00/trial
Learn English with the teacher Russell.
5.0

2,240 Lessons

Russell

Community Tutorid verified
Speaks :English
Native
Spanish
+1

I have a passion for languages, cultures, and helping others find their unique voice in English. Whether you love chatting about books, movies, sports, or your favorite hobbies, we'll explore the fun and fascinating world of English together. I'm here to make learning engaging, interactive, and a bit adventurous.

USD 13.50/Hour
Available 17:00 Today
Learn English with the teacher John Castle.
5.0

4,721 Lessons

John Castle

Community Tutorid verified
Speaks :English
Native
Spanish
+1

{Certified TESOL Teacher} Improve your English by having a natural conversation with a native tutor! I have been teaching English online for the past 7 years, holding my TESOL Certificate. I love teaching and helping students from all over the world. I have helped students pass their IELTS test to move or study abroad by improving their grammar, pronunciation, vocabulary and listening skills. Helping students reach their goals brings me so much joy. I am very diligent so I will correct you and focus on your weaknesses. I only teach adults. Thank you.

USD 12.50/trial
Learn English with the teacher John.
5.0

8,612 Lessons

John

Community Tutorid verified
Speaks :English
Native
+1

Native English speaker with a science background My experience teaching college classes has made me a patient teacher who knows the importance of being open, accessible, and honest. I have taught courses that typically have a reputation for being difficult, and so I have experience working with students one-on-one to help them succeed. I am not a rigid teacher but instead someone who is willing to be flexible and adaptable.

USD 6.75/trial
Available 13:00 Tomorrow
Learn English with the teacher Carmen.
4.9

619 Lessons

Carmen

Community Tutorid verified
Speaks :English
Native

In everything I do in this life, I always make a solid effort to be KIND. With this being said, I do understand that in anything we do, there is a strive for perfection, especially when honing the skills to survive and thrive in another language or culture. I've also got a sense of humor, am not easily offended and would encourage my students to laugh when they feel like it and to never, ever be embarrassed. It is such a show of respect and strength to see another person take on a whole new language to conquer. You deserve to be celebrated! 📍 Freetalk 📍 Kids 📍 IELTS 📍 Editing 📍 Job/interview prep, investor decks

USD 9.00/trial
Available 02:00 Tomorrow
Learn English with the teacher Ahmed Deiab.
5.0

9,308 Lessons

Ahmed Deiab

Community Tutorid verified
Speaks :English
Arabic
Native
Arabic (Egyptian)
Native
Arabic (Modern Standard)
Native
+1

I understand how difficult and frustrating it may be for someone who learns a new language such as Arabic, therefore, my goal is to make the lesson as easy and simple as possible. I will do my best to make the learning process enjoyable and useful in order to maintain your enthusiasm, and for you to reap the fruits of your efforts quickly. I will create a friendly learning environment, encourage you to speak from the first day without pressure and together we will develop a plan that suits you and meets your needs.

USD 5.00/trial
Learn English with the teacher Ren.
4.9

1,215 Lessons

Ren

Community Tutorid verified
Speaks :English
Native
Filipino (Tagalog)
Native
+7

✅ TEFL English / Tagalog / Kapampangan Tutor As a teacher, I always make sure that my students achieve their language goals and create an environment where they can be fully immersed in their target language.

USD 8.00/trial
Learn English with the teacher Ayman Fawy.
5.0

1,530 Lessons

Ayman Fawy

Community Tutorid verified
Speaks :English
Arabic
Native
Arabic (Egyptian)
Native
Arabic (Modern Standard)
Native

HIGH QUALITY. VERY LOW PRICE. Structured lessons with proven textbooks and certified teacher. As a native Arabic speaker with a passion for teaching, I offer lessons that are tailored to your goals, level, and learning style. Whether you're a complete beginner or looking to refine your fluency, I adapt each session to meet your needs. 🧠 My teaching style is interactive, supportive, and focused on real-life communication. I believe that learning should be enjoyable and practical—so expect a lot of speaking practice, useful vocabulary, and cultural insights from day one!

USD 5.00/trial
Available 17:00 Today
Learn English with the teacher Lani.

Lani

Community Tutorid verified
Speaks :English
Native
Spanish
+1

TEFL/TESOL Certified English Tutor! Let’s Improve Your English Together! Fluent, Confident & Natural As a teacher, I’m patient, supportive, and genuinely passionate about helping people feel confident when they speak English. I understand what it feels like to learn a new language, so I always create a safe, friendly space where students can ask questions and practise without fear. I focus on real-life English, everyday conversations, workplace communication, and natural Australian expressions, so my students can succeed in any situation. My goal is to make English simple, natural, and enjoyable for everyone.

USD 13.00/trial
Available 22:00 Today
Learn English with the teacher Alina Zelinska.
5.0

3,499 Lessons

Alina Zelinska

Community Tutorid verified
Speaks :English
Russian
Native
Ukrainian
Native
+2

Ukrainian, Russian & English Teacher | Structured lessons & real-life speaking My lessons are fun and practical! We speak, explore grammar, read texts, and sometimes play games or use music — all to help you actually use the language. I like to explain things clearly, so you understand why something works, not just memorize rules. You can always ask questions — mistakes are welcome and part of learning. I adapt lessons to your level and goals, helping you feel more confident and natural when speaking.

USD 13.00/trial
Available 16:00 Today
Learn English with the teacher BilProfessionaltutor.
4.8

146 Lessons

BilProfessionaltutor

Community Tutorid verified
Speaks :English
Hindi
Sindhi
Urdu
Afrikaans
Native
Balochi
+3

⭐Certified English Tutor from Australia ⭐3 YEARS of experience ⭐Conversational Fluency expert ⭐ I'm easy going , diligent , I have world of patience and i will teach you at your own pace and I am a native speaker in English and Sindhi , I'm also fluent in Hindi and Urdu. I have broad experience teaching students from South America, Europe and Asia. I love teaching and I'm ready to help you with different and easy methods for optimized learning. I create and cater my own materials to the needs of my students. Don't hesitate to get in touch with me! .

USD 6.00/trial
Available 16:00 Today
Learn English with the teacher Aldo.
5.0

7,381 Lessons

Aldo

Community Tutorid verified
Business
Speaks :English
Native
Spanish
Native
French
+2

Former College English Tutor - BA/BS Economics - Certified in Financial Accounting - Harvard (HBSO) My teaching philosophy is that every single person is unique and hides a treasure within waiting to be discovered, understanding and adapting to a student's needs and method of learning is crucial to accomplish success as a teacher. I'm an empathetic teacher who understands very well the challenges faced as a student, I believe that my experience and guidance can be exceptional to walk someone through the path of knowledge acquisition. I'm a very patient teacher who follows the student's pace, we always walk together through a path of mutual understanding.

USD 14.00/trial
Available 16:00 Today
Learn English with the teacher Serena Yan.

Serena Yan

Community Tutorid verified
Speaks :English
Native
Chinese (Mandarin)
Native
Japanese

Native English Speaker | Speak English Confidently and Business English with a Former Consultant I’m a patient, supportive, and encouraging teacher. I know how frustrating it can be to understand a language but struggle to speak it naturally. My goal is to help you feel more confident, comfortable, and clear when expressing yourself in English. I focus on real communication, not perfection, and I create a relaxed space where making mistakes is part of learning.

USD 10.00/trial
Available 04:00 Tomorrow
Learn English with the teacher Erik.
5.0

2,502 Lessons

Erik

Community Tutorid verified
Speaks :English
Swedish
Native
Latin
Italian
Arabic (Modern Standard)
French
+1

Passionate language teacher with years of experience I'm flexible, consistent and strive to adapt to your needs. After a consultation we can find out what works best for you based on you as a person and what suits your goals. I always try to make sure that language learning is never boring, so I always try to make sure that my lessons are fun while making progress and learning, which itself is fun too!

USD 7.00/trial
Learn English with the teacher Yaprak Brooke.
5.0

1,757 Lessons

Yaprak Brooke

Community Tutorid verified
Speaks :English
Native
Turkish
Native
+2

HEY global FRIEND! Laid-Back American English Conversation (+more:) I'm approachable, personable and mainly conversational in my sessions.

USD 14.00/trial
Available 21:00 Today
Learn English with the teacher Ziyoda.
5.0

882 Lessons

Ziyoda

Community Tutorid verified
Speaks :English
Native
Uzbek
Native
Russian
Native
Malay
+3

Uzbek language - English - Interview preparation As a teacher, I am a native Uzbek and I have studied Uzbek literature and philology during my College years. I have perused my higher education in Education field as well. I studied Teaching of English as a Second Language and obtained skilled professionalism. I have experience of teaching English a little over 4 years now. I am a very determined and committed to my students academic goals and I always make sure to maintain my professional standards, ethics and consistency. I will help you with grammar, vocabulary, speaking and pronunciation and also with your reading and writing skills.

USD 6.00/trial
Available 01:30 Tomorrow
Learn English with the teacher Walid.
4.9

5,165 Lessons

Walid

Community Tutorid verified
Kids
Test Preparation
Speaks :English
Arabic
Native
French
Arabic (Maghrebi)
Native
Berber (Tamazight)
Native
+4

Experienced TEF Canada Specialist with 8+ Years and 5000+ Lessons Taught to 500+ Students I have taught French, English and Arabic to students from all over the world, mainly adults, at all levels, in groups as well as in private lessons. Those classes included the preparation to exams such as DELF & DALF & TEF & TCF. I draw on my experience both as a language teacher and as a language student to deliver the best quality teaching I can, using resources such as PDF files, articles, homework assignments etc. for me teaching means being there to give content and structure but also a supportive presence.

USD 15.00/trial
Available 16:00 Today
Learn English with the teacher ISMA.
4.9

299 Lessons

ISMA

Community Tutorid verified
Technology
Business
Speaks :English
Urdu
Native
Hindi
Punjabi
+1

"Certified English Tutor Specializing in Conversation, Exam Prep, and Professional Growth" As an English tutor with iTalki, I am eager to embark on this journey of teaching and learning together, and I look forward to making a positive impact in the lives of my students, helping them achieve their goals and aspirations one lesson at a time. Together, we will embark on an exciting voyage of language discovery, where every challenge is an opportunity for growth, and every success is a testament to our collective dedication.

USD 5.00/trial
Your final payment will be made in USD

Frequently asked questions

What qualifications do your English teachers have?

At italki, we are committed to providing our users with the best possible language learning experience. Therefore, we take the selection and qualification of our English teachers very seriously.

All our English teachers are native speakers or certified bilingual speakers of English. They have completed a rigorous application process, which includes an assessment of their teaching experience, qualifications, and language proficiency. We also require them to have at least one teaching certification, such as CELTA, TEFL, or TESOL.

Our English teachers come from various backgrounds and have different teaching styles, but they share a passion for teaching and a commitment to helping their students improve their English skills. Some of them have been teaching for years, while others are relatively new to the field, but all of them are dedicated to providing their students with high-quality English instruction.

Moreover, we regularly evaluate our English teachers to ensure they meet our standards for quality and effectiveness. If a teacher fails to meet our requirements, we remove them from our platform. Therefore, our users can rest assured that they are learning English from qualified and experienced teachers who are committed to helping them achieve their language learning goals.

Can I choose between one-on-one lessons or group classes?

One-on-one lessons are great for personalized attention and a curriculum tailored to your specific needs. It allows you to focus on your weaknesses and improve at your own pace. You can choose a teacher that matches your learning style and schedule lessons that work for you.

On the other hand, group classes are great for those who prefer to learn with others and practice speaking with classmates. It provides an opportunity to learn from peers and engage in group discussions. It’s also a more affordable option compared to one-on-one lessons.

At italki, we offer both options so that you can choose what works best for you. You can easily filter your search to find teachers who offer either one-on-one lessons or group classes, and you can switch between the two depending on your needs and preferences.

Are the English classes and courses suitable for beginners?

Yes, our English classes and courses are suitable for beginners. We understand that everyone has different learning levels and goals, and our experienced English teachers can adjust their teaching methods accordingly. Our beginner-level classes focus on building a strong foundation in the English language, including basic grammar, vocabulary, and pronunciation. Our teachers use various teaching techniques such as interactive activities, games, and multimedia resources to make the learning process fun and engaging. Additionally, our one-on-one lessons allow beginners to receive personalized attention and guidance from their teacher. Our online platform also offers flexibility, which means that beginners can choose a suitable time and pace that suits their learning needs. Whether you are starting from scratch or have some prior knowledge of English, our classes and courses are tailored to meet your needs and help you progress to the next level.

How can I improve my speaking skills in English?

Improving speaking skills in English is a common goal for many language learners. To improve your speaking skills in English, it is important to practice regularly with a native conversational English teacher or tutor. During your classes or lessons, you can work on your pronunciation, intonation, and vocabulary by practicing speaking on different topics, engaging in conversation, and receiving feedback from your teacher. It is also helpful to engage in English language immersion by watching TV shows or movies, listening to podcasts or music, or speaking with native speakers outside of class. Additionally, using language-learning apps or practicing with language exchange partners can provide an opportunity to practice speaking skills in a more relaxed setting. By combining regular practice with immersive experiences and using various language-learning tools, you can improve your speaking skills in English and achieve your language goals.

Can I learn English at my own pace?

Yes, you can definitely learn English at your own pace. At italki, we offer flexible schedules for our online English classes and courses to accommodate your needs and preferences. You can choose from one-on-one lessons or group classes based on your learning style and level. Our experienced and qualified English teachers will design customized lesson plans that are tailored to your goals and pace, so you can learn English comfortably and confidently.

Moreover, you will have access to our online learning platform, which includes a variety of resources such as podcasts, interactive exercises, tips for learning languages, and practice materials. You can review and practice the course materials at your own pace and schedule, so you can enhance your English skills at a pace that works for you.

Our main goal is to help you achieve your English language goals, and we believe that learning at your own pace is one of the most effective ways to learn a new language. So, whether you want to learn English for personal or professional reasons, we have the resources and expertise to support your learning journey.

Ready to start your English learning journey? Book a trial lesson with one of our experienced English tutors today and take your first step towards fluency.

English learning articles you may like